Background
Bactericides are also known as biocides, bactericidal algicides, microbicides and the like, and generally refer to chemical preparations which can effectively control or kill microorganisms, such as bacteria, fungi and algae, in water systems, and are generally known internationally as agents for controlling various pathogenic microorganisms;

Example 1
Referring to fig. 1-7, the present invention provides a cleaning device for producing bactericide, comprising a base 100 and a stirring barrel 300 disposed above the base 100, the base 100 is connected to a cleaning device 200 disposed above the stirring barrel 300, the cleaning device 200 comprises a cleaning frame 210, a disk 211 is disposed at the center of the interior of the cleaning frame 210, a rotating cavity 2110 is disposed inside the disk 211, the cleaning rod 220 is rotatably connected inside the rotating cavity 2110, a connecting ball 221 is disposed at the bottom end of the cleaning rod 220, extending rods 2211 are disposed at the left and right ends of the connecting ball 221, a bristle brush 2212 is fixed at one end of the extending rod 2211 far away from the connecting ball 221, the cleaning rod 220 is disposed inside the stirring barrel 300, the bristle face of the bristle brush 2212 is attached to the inner wall of the stirring barrel 300, the bristle face of the bristle brush 2212 is rotated around the center of the cleaning rod 220 by the rotation between the cleaning rod 220 and the disk 211, the bristle brush 2212 is rubbed with the interior of the stirring barrel 300 during the rotation, dirt on the inner wall of the cleaning frame can be cleaned, the front end of the cleaning frame 210 is provided with a front projection 212, the upper surface of the front end of the base 100 is provided with a hydraulic rod 110, the hydraulic rod 110 is preferably a piston type hydraulic cylinder, the working principle of the device is as known by those skilled in the art, the device takes gas and liquid as working media, and consists of a pressure pipe, a piston rod and a plurality of connecting pieces, high-pressure nitrogen is filled in the piston, because the through hole is arranged in the piston, the gas pressure at two ends of the piston is equal, the sectional areas at two sides of the piston are different, one end is connected with a piston rod, and the other end is not, under the action of the gas pressure, pressure toward the side with the small cross section is generated, so that the piston rod moves, the top end of the hydraulic rod 110 is fixedly connected with the front convex block 212, can drive cleaning equipment 200 through hydraulic stem 110 work and carry out the up-and-down motion, be convenient for carry out comprehensive clearance with agitator 300 inner wall.

Further, one end of the sliding block 131 is provided with a fitting block 1312 which facilitates enlarging the contact area between the sliding block 131 and the stirring barrel 300, and one end of the screw 132 is provided with a rotating handle 1321 which facilitates using the screw 132.
When the cleaning device for producing bactericide in this embodiment is used specifically, first, the stirring barrel 300 is placed at the center of the upper surface of the base 100 and is located between the plurality of stabilizing blocks 130, then the rotating handle 1321 is held to apply clockwise force to drive the screw 132 and the threaded hole 1301 to rotate, meanwhile, the screw 132 and the rotating head 1311 rotate, the sliding block 131 slowly approaches to the direction of the stirring barrel 300 by continuously rotating the rotating handle 1321, until the adhering block 1312 is tightly attached to the surface of the stirring barrel 300, then the motor 2213 is powered on to work, the motor 2213 works to drive the cleaning rod 220 to rotate, the extension rod 2211 drives the brush 2212 to rotate by the rotation of the cleaning rod 220, the brush 2212 rotates to rub against the inner wall of the stirring barrel 300, dirt on the inner wall of the stirring barrel 300 is separated by the friction force, so as to play a cleaning role, the hydraulic rod 110 works to drive the sliding rod 121 and the telescopic rod 120 to slide, thereby drive cleaning equipment 200 up-and-down motion, be convenient for clear up the agitator 300 inner wall comprehensively.
